框架仅在设备

问题描述:

该项目造成坠机整天罚款运行,然后突然的,当我在设备上运行崩溃(但可在仿真器):框架仅在设备

使dyld:库未加载:@rpath /Bolts.framework/Bolts引用 来自:

/var/mobile/Containers/Bundle/Application/.../MyApp.app/MyApp

原因:未找到图像

我的项目使用迦太基为其他框架,但对于解析和螺栓我手动导入一切。我似乎无法解决这个问题;有任何想法吗?

+0

你有没有试过http://*.com/q/24333981/5276890? –

+0

@RoyFalk是的,我已经尝试了所有这一切,它仍然在设备上运行时崩溃。我不明白为什么会发生这种情况,因为之前这个项目一直在与这些框架一起工作 – vikzilla

我通过删除Xcode的Derived Data文件夹解决了这个问题。我以前只尝试删除这个特定项目的派生数据,但显然需要删除整个派生数据。希望这有助于某人,这令人难以置信的令人沮丧!

我有类似的问题。该项目在模拟器中工作,但没有在设备上工作。问题是我在copy-frameworks运行脚本中以小写字母代替大写字母的框架名称中有一个字母。在Simulator上工作(Mac默认情况下不区分大小写的文件系统),但在设备上不起作用(iOS使用区分大小写的文件系统)。